About Whorlton

Whorlton is a small village located in North Yorkshire, England, within the DL6 postcode area. It is situated near the River Tees, offering a scenic view of the surrounding countryside. The village features traditional stone-built houses, giving it a classic English village feel. Whorlton is also known for its historic church, St. Mary’s, which dates back to the 12th century and is an important landmark in the area. The village is conveniently located close to the larger town of Northallerton, providing access to a range of amenities and services. Visitors can enjoy walks along the river or explore the nearby landscapes, which are ideal for outdoor activities. Whorlton serves as a peaceful retreat for those looking to experience the beauty of North Yorkshire’s countryside while remaining accessible to urban conveniences.
